Who makes the Zetec engine?

Ford designed the Zeta to share some parts with other Ford engine developments at the time, including the smaller Sigma I-4 and larger Duratec V6. This engine shares its bore and stroke dimensions with the 2-valve CVH engine. Ford Power Products sells the Zeta in 1.8 L and 2.0 L versions as the MVH.

What is the difference between a Zetec and a Duratec engine?

The biggest differences between the Zetec and Duratec are: Zetec is an iron block, Duratec is aluminum. Belt driven non-interference cams on the Zetec, chain driven interference cams on the Duratec. Exhaust is on the front of the Zetec, while its in the back on the Duratec.

How rare is SVT Focus?

Ford made 4,788 units of the Focus SVT for the 2002 model year, and the entire production run didn’t last beyond 2004, so these are pretty rare vehicles, especially unmodified examples. With just about 110k on the odometer, it hasn’t been driven too much in its nearly two decades on the road.

Which is better Ford Zetec or Duratec?

The 2.0L Duratec is superior in every way imaginable to the garden variety Zetec – more efficient, more powerful, more responsive to mods. But the 2.0 can only be found in an ’05 and up Focus, which in all other respects was not nearly as good a car.
